Methods of monitoring melanoma progression in a subject comprise, in a test sample, determining expression levels of novel marker genes. These genes are selected from, inter alia, TSPY1, CYBA and MT2A. Methods of diagnosing melanoma also include determining the methylation status of markers whose methylation status has now been shown to be linked to progression of melanoma. Microarrays, screening methods, primers and methods of treatment of melanoma are also described based around the novel marker genes. |
